: Our study focuses on post-operative nausea and vomiting (PONV) in middle ear surgery, a horrible experience to both doctors and patients. We compared the efficacy of granisetron and ondansetron alone and their combination with dexamethasone, for prevention of PONV in middle ear surgery. Methods: 125 patients (63 females, 62 males) with a age group between 10 to 60 years , who underwent middle ear surgery were randomly allocated and divided into 5 groups (25 patients in each group) according to the drug they receive i.e, Group-A (control group-no antiemetic), Group-B (granisetron 40mcg/kg), Group-C (granisetron 40mcg/kg + dexamethasone 8mg), Group-D (ondansetron .1mg/kg), Group-E (ondansetron .1mg/kg+ dexamethasone 8mg). After a standard protocol used in all of them, all the groups were evaluated for post-operative nausea , retching and vomiting and their side effects immediately at extubation for 24 hours of anesthesia. Results: The incidence of PONV is different in all groups i.e., maximum in group A (76%) followed by group D (28%), then group B (16%),then group E (12%) and minimum in group C (8%) and statistically significant (p <.001). The incidence of PONV was maximum during first 6 hours, but group B & group C showed higher incidence during first 12 hours whereas group D showed higher incidence during late postoperative period. Conclusion: Prophylactic combination antiemetic therapy of granisetron (40mcg/kg) dexamethasone (8mg) was found to be superior to individual therapy of granisetron and ondansetron and combination therapy of ondansetron (.1mg/kg) and dexamethasone (8mg) in middle ear surgery
